TAHLIA WATERS HR CONSULTING LLP is seeking an experienced Project Manager to oversee power system projects in Penarth, UK. The role requires a Diploma or Degree in Electrical Engineering or Power Engineering along with at least 2 years of project management experience.
The successful candidate will handle all aspects of project delivery, including:
- Managing materials
- Communication with customers
- Ensuring on-time delivery while maintaining profit margins
Strong organizational and interpersonal skills are essential for success in this position.
